Vulnerabilities and Exploits

To protect your devices, it’s crucial to stay aware of the vulnerabilities and exploits that can compromise their security. Exploit prevention is a critical aspect of maintaining strong digital defenses.

Software vulnerabilities are weaknesses or flaws in computer programs that could be exploited by attackers to gain unauthorized access or control over your device. These vulnerabilities can exist in any software, from operating systems to applications and even firmware.

Attackers are constantly looking for these vulnerabilities and developing exploits to take advantage of them. They may use techniques like buffer overflow, code injection, or privilege escalation to exploit the weaknesses in software. Once an attacker successfully exploits a vulnerability, they can execute malicious code on your device, steal sensitive information, or even take complete control over it.

Regularly updating your software is one of the most effective ways to prevent exploitation. Software updates often include patches that address known vulnerabilities and strengthen the overall security of the program. By keeping your software up-to-date, you reduce the chances of falling victim to exploits targeting known vulnerabilities.

Potential Cyber Threats Prevention

Now that we have discussed vulnerability mitigation strategies, let’s delve into the importance of potential cyber threats detection and effective cyber defense strategies. In today’s digital landscape, it’s crucial to stay one step ahead of adversaries who continuously seek to exploit vulnerabilities in software systems.

To detect potential cyber threats, organizations must employ advanced threat detection mechanisms such as intrusion detection systems (IDS) and security information and event management (SIEM) tools. These technologies monitor network traffic, log events, and analyze patterns to identify suspicious activities or anomalies that could indicate a potential attack.

Once a threat is detected, organizations need robust cyber defense strategies in place to mitigate the risk. This includes implementing firewalls, antivirus software, and encryption protocols to protect sensitive data from unauthorized access. Additionally, regular software updates play a vital role by patching known vulnerabilities and strengthening system defenses against emerging threats.

Enhancing System Defense

To enhance your system defense against potential cyber threats, you should consider implementing multi-factor authentication and conducting regular security audits.

Multi-factor authentication adds an extra layer of protection by requiring users to provide multiple forms of verification before accessing sensitive information. This reduces the risk of unauthorized access, even if a password is compromised.

Regular security audits are also crucial for identifying vulnerabilities in your system and addressing them promptly. By analyzing your security controls and protocols, you can identify any weaknesses or gaps that could be exploited by hackers.
